The annual salary statistics of diagnostic medical sonographers in Miami-Miami Beach-Kendall, Florida is shown in Table 1. The wage statistics of diagnostic medical sonographers in Miami-Miami Beach-Kendall is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$39,980 |
25th Percentile Wage | $53,300 |
50th Percentile Wage | $60,910 |
75th Percentile Wage | $71,730 |
90th Percentile Wage | $80,180 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for diagnostic medical sonographers in Miami-Miami Beach-Kendall, Florida in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$80,180.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$60,910.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$39,980.
